CRVO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review
48 of the 8,223 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CervoMed (CRVO)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$17.4M — up 0.93% from $17.3M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 9 funds opened new CRVO posit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 12 added to existing stakes and 15 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$486K. The largest seller was AWM Investment Company, cutting an estimated $551K.
